Protein Variants | Comment | Organism |
---|---|---|
F483S | the mutant shows loss of enzyme activity. The mutation leads to D-glyceric acidemia | Homo sapiens |
F493C | the mutant shows loss of enzyme activity. The mutation leads to D-glyceric acidemia | Homo sapiens |
L510C | the mutant shows loss of enzyme activity. The mutation leads to D-glyceric acidemia | Homo sapiens |
